New York Women in Business (NYWIB) urges immediate action to preserve vital entrepreneurial support The future of 100,000 women-owned small businesses in New York hangs in the balance. Proposed federal budget cuts to SCORE —a critical nonprofit partner of the U.S. Small Business Administration—threaten to eliminate the foundation behind one of the city's most vital entrepreneurial networks: New York Women in Business (NYWIB). Founded in 2016 by marketing veteran Mary Tan, a longtime SCORE mentor, NYWIB was built by—and continues to operate because of—SCORE's resources, volunteers, and infrastructure. Without SCORE, NYWIB will not survive. For nearly a decade, NYWIB has helped women turn ideas into income, passion into purpose, and side hustles into sustainable livelihoods. That entire ecosystem is now at risk. 'This isn't just a funding cut. It's a direct hit to women fighting to build something for themselves and their families,' said Tan, who has mentored more than 2,000 entrepreneurs through SCORE. 'Defunding SCORE means the end of NYWIB—and silencing thousands of women's voices, dreams, and economic potential.' The True Cost Of Defunding SCORE Nationally, SCORE's 10,000+ volunteer mentors serve over 100,000 small business clients annually, helping to create and sustain jobs while generating billions in economic impact. In New York alone, SCORE's network supports thousands of entrepreneurs each year. Without SCORE's guidance, the ripple effects would be devastating: SCORE clients are 3x more likely to start a business and 2x more likely to remain in business after two years compared to non-clients. About SCORE SCORE is a nonprofit association dedicated to helping small businesses get off the ground, grow, and achieve their goals through education and mentorship. SCORE's 10,000+ volunteer business mentors have relevant experience and training to help you succeed.
